Abstract Purpose To appraise the role of stereotactic body radiation therapy (SBRT) in patients with lung metastasis from primary soft tissue sarcoma. Methods Twenty-eight patients (51 lesions) were ...analysed. All patients were in good performance status (1–2 eastern cooperative oncology group (ECOG)), unsuitable for surgical resection, with controlled primary tumour and the number of lung metastases was ⩽4. In a risk adaptive scheme, the dose prescription was: 30 Gy/1 fr, 60 Gy/3 fr, 60 Gy/8 fr and 48 Gy/4 fr. Treatments were performed with Volumetric Modulated Arc Therapy. Clinical outcome was evaluated by thoracic and abdominal computed tomography (CT) scan before SBRT and than every 3 months. Toxicity was evaluated with Common Terminology Criteria for Adverse Events (CTCAE) scale version 4.0. Results Leiomyosarcoma (36%) and synovial sarcoma (25%) were the most common histologies. Five patients (18%) initially presented with pulmonary metastasis, whereas 23 (82%) developed them at a median time of 51 months (range 11–311 months) from the initial diagnosis. The median follow-up time from initial diagnosis was 65 months (5–139 months) and from SBRT was 21 months (2–80 months). No severe toxicity (grades III–IV) was recorded and no patients required hospitalisation. The actuarial 5-years local control rate (from SBRT treatment) was 96%. Overall survival at 2 and 5 years was 96.2% and 60.5%, respectively. At last follow-up 15 patients (54%) were alive. All other died because of distant progression. Conclusions SBRT provides excellent local control of pulmonary metastasis from soft tissue sarcoma (STS) and may improve survival in selected patients. SBRT should be considered for all patients with pulmonary metastasis (PM) and evaluated in a multidisciplinary team.

Introduction
The public–private ADVANCE collaboration developed and tested a system to generate evidence on vaccine benefits and risks using European electronic healthcare databases. In the safety of ...vaccines, background incidence rates are key to allow proper monitoring and assessment. The goals of this study were to compute age-, sex-, and calendar-year stratified incidence rates of nine autoimmune diseases in seven European healthcare databases from four countries and to assess validity by comparing with published data.
Methods
Event rates were calculated for the following outcomes: acute disseminated encephalomyelitis, Bell’s palsy, Guillain–Barré syndrome, immune thrombocytopenia purpura, Kawasaki disease, optic neuritis, narcolepsy, systemic lupus erythematosus, and transverse myelitis. Cases were identified by diagnosis codes. Participating organizations/databases originated from Denmark, Italy, Spain, and the UK. The source population comprised all persons registered, with at least 1 year of data prior to the study start, or follow-up from birth. Stratified incidence rates were computed per database over the period 2003 to 2014.
Results
Between 2003 and 2014, 148,947 incident cases of nine autoimmune diseases were identified. Crude incidence rates were highest for Bell’s palsy 23.8/100,000 person-years (PYs), 95% confidence interval (CI) 23.6–24.1 and lowest for Kawasaki disease (0.7/100,000 PYs, 95% CI 0.6–0.7). Specific patterns were observed by sex, age, calendar time, and data sources. Rates were comparable with published estimates.
Conclusion
A range of autoimmune events could be identified in the ADVANCE system. Estimation of rates indicated consistency across selected European healthcare databases, as well as consistency with US published data.

The problem of vortex shedding, which occurs when an obstacle is placed in a regular flow, is governed by Reynolds and Strouhal numbers, known by dimensional analysis. The present work aims to ...propose a thin films-based device, consisting of an elastic piezoelectric flapping flag clamped at one end, in order to determine the frequency of vortex shedding downstream an obstacle for a flow field at Reynolds number Re∼103 in the open channel. For these values, Strouhal number obtained in such way is in accordance with the results known in literature. Moreover, the development of the voltage over time, generated by the flapping flag under the load due to flow field, shows a highly fluctuating behavior and satisfies Taylor’s law, observed in several complex systems. This provided useful information about the flow field through the constitutive law of the device.

Colorectal cancer (CRC) screening programs help diagnose cancer precursors and early cancers and help reduce CRC mortality. However, currently recommended tests, the fecal immunochemical test (FIT) ...and colonoscopy, have low uptake. There is therefore a pressing need for screening strategies that are minimally invasive and consequently more acceptable to patients, most likely blood based, to increase early CRC identification. MicroRNAs (miRNAs) released from cancer cells are detectable in plasma in a remarkably stable form, making them ideal cancer biomarkers. Using plasma samples from FIT‐positive (FIT+) subjects in an Italian CRC screening program, we aimed to identify plasma circulating miRNAs that detect early CRC. miRNAs were initially investigated by quantitative real‐time PCR in plasma from 60 FIT+ subjects undergoing colonoscopy at Fondazione IRCCS Istituto Nazionale dei Tumori, then tested on an internal validation cohort (IVC, 201 cases) and finally in a large multicenter prospective series (external validation cohort EVC, 1121 cases). For each endoscopic lesion (low‐grade adenoma LgA, high‐grade adenoma HgA, cancer lesion CL), specific signatures were identified in the IVC and confirmed on the EVC. A two‐miRNA‐based signature for CL and six‐miRNA signatures for LgA and HgA were selected. In a multivariate analysis including sex and age at blood collection, the areas under the receiver operating characteristic curve (95% confidence interval) of the signatures were 0.644 (0.607–0.682), 0.670 (0.626–0.714) and 0.682 (0.580–0.785) for LgA, HgA and CL, respectively. A miRNA‐based test could be introduced into the FIT+ workflow of CRC screening programs so as to schedule colonoscopies only for subjects likely to benefit most.
What's new?
Colon cancer screening currently focusses on stool samples, but precancerous adenomas are not reliably recognized by occult blood‐based or immunochemical tests. Here the authors identify three plasma circulating miRNA‐based signatures that can detect among the individuals positive for the fecal immunochemical test those with precancerous and cancerous lesions. They propose that a blood test based on these signatures could be an additional analysis in individuals with positive fecal test to limit the number of colonoscopies to those likely to benefit most.

Dune recovery interventions that integrate natural, sustainable, and soft solutions have become increasingly popular in coastal communities. In the present study, the reliability of an innovative ...non-toxic colloidal silica-based solution for coastal sand dunes has been verified for the first time by means of laboratory experiments. An extensive experimental campaign aimed at studying the effectiveness of the use of nanosilica has been conducted in the 2D wave flume of the EUMER laboratory at the University of Salento (Italy). The study was first based on a horizontal seabed and then a cross-shore beach-dune profile was drawn similar to those generally observed in nature. Detailed measurements of wave characteristics and observed bed and cross-shore beach-dune profiles were analyzed for a wide range of wave conditions. In both cases, two sets of experiments were carried out. After the first set of experiments performed resembling the native conditions of the models composed with natural sand, the effects of the injection of the mineral colloidal silica-based grout were investigated. The observations show that mineral colloidal silica increases the mechanical strength of non-cohesive sediments reducing the volume of dune erosion, thus improving the resistance and longevity of the beach-dune system.
Percutaneous endoscopic gastrostomy (PEG) is the most common endoscopic procedure used to provide nutritional support.
To prospectively evaluate the mortality and complication incidences after PEG ...insertion or replacement.
All patients who underwent PEG insertion or replacement were included. Details on patient characteristics, ongoing therapies, comorbidities, and indication for PEG placement/replacement were collected, along with informed consent form signatures. Early and late (30-day) complications and mortality were assessed.
950 patients (47.1% male) were enrolled in 25 centers in Lombardy, a region of Northern Italy. Patient mean age was 73 years. 69.5% of patients had ASA status 3 or 4. First PEG placement was performed in 594 patients. Complication and mortality incidences were 4.8% and 5.2%, respectively. The most frequent complication was infection (50%), followed by bleeding (32.1%), tube dislodgment (14.3%), and buried bumper syndrome (3.6%). At multivariable analysis, age (OR 1.08 per 1-year increase, 95% CI, 1.0–1.16, p = 0.010) and BMI (OR 0.86 per 1-point increase, 95% CI, 0.77−0.96, p = 0.014) were factors associated with mortality.
PEG replacement was carried out in 356 patients. Thirty-day mortality was 1.8%, while complications occurred in 1.7% of patients.
Our data confirm that PEG placement is a safe procedure. Mortality was not related to the procedure itself, confirming that careful patient selection is warranted.

Background
Benign anastomotic colonic stenosis sometimes occur after surgery and usually require surgical or endoscopic dilation. Endoscopic dilation of anastomotic colonic strictures by using ...balloon or bougie-type dilators has been demonstrated to be safe and effective in multiple uncontrolled series. However, few data are available on safety and efficacy of endoscopic electrocautery dilation. The aim of our study was to retrospectively investigate safety and efficacy of endoscopic electrocautery dilation of postsurgical benign anastomotic colonic strictures.
Methods
Sixty patients (37 women; median age 63.6 years, range 22.6–81.7) with benign anastomotic colonic or rectal strictures treated with endoscopic electrocautery dilation between June 2001 and February 2013 were included in the study. Anastomotic stricture was defined as a narrowed anastomosis through which a standard colonoscope could not be passed. Only annular anastomotic strictures were considered suitable for electrocautery dilation which consisted of radial incisions performed with a precut sphincterotome. Treatment was considered successful if the colonic anastomosis could be passed by a standard colonoscope immediately after dilation. Recurrence was defined as anastomotic stricture reappearance during follow-up.
Results
The time interval between colorectal surgery and the first endoscopic evaluation or symptoms development was 7.3 months (1.3–60.7). Electrocautery dilation was successful in all the patients. There were no procedure-related complications. Median follow-up was 35.5 months (2.0–144.0). Anastomotic stricture recurrence was observed in three patients who were successfully treated with electrocautery dilation and Savary dilation.
Conclusions
Endoscopic electrocautery dilation is a safe and effective treatment for annular benign anastomotic postsurgical colonic strictures.

BackgroundThe management of locally advanced rectal cancer (LARC) relies on a multimodal approach. Neither instrumental work-up nor molecular biomarkers are currently available to identify a ...risk-adapted strategy.ObjectivesWe aim to investigate the role of circulating tumor DNA (ctDNA) and its clearance at different timepoints during chemo-radiotherapy (CRT) and correlate them with clinical outcomes.DesignBetween November 2014 and November 2019, we conducted a monocentric prospective observational study enrolling consecutive patients with LARC managed with neoadjuvant standard CRT (capecitabine and concomitant pelvic long-course radiotherapy), followed by consolidation capecitabine in selected cases and surgery.MethodsBlood samples for ctDNA were obtained at pre-planned timepoints. We evaluated the correlation of baseline variant allele frequency (VAF) with pathologic complete response (pCR) down-staging, node regression (pN0), event-free survival (EFS), and overall survival (OS).ResultsAmong 112 screened patients, 61 were enrolled. In all, 38 (62%) had a positive ctDNA at baseline with VAF > 0 and 23 had negative ctDNA (VAF = 0). Among patients with negative ctDNA, 30% had a complete response, while only 13% of positive ctDNA patients had pCR odds ratio (OR) 0.35 (95% confidence interval (CI): 0.10-1.26), p = 0.11. Similarly, 96% and 74% of pN0 were observed among negative and positive ctDNA patients, respectively OR 0.13 (95% CI: 0.02-1.07), p = 0.058. The presence of a baseline VAF > 0 was associated with a trend toward a lower EFS compared with VAF = 0 patients hazard ratio (HR) = 2.30, 95% CI: 0.63-8.36, p = 0.21. Within the limitations of small sample size, no difference in OS was observed according to the baseline ctDNA status (HR = 1.18, 95% CI: 0.35-4.06, p = 0.79).ConclusionWithin the limitations of a reduced number of patients, patients with baseline negative ctDNA seem to show a higher probability of pN0 status and a trend toward improved EFS. Prospective translational studies are required to define the role of ctDNA analysis in the multimodal treatment of LARC.
